Fact Check: Authorities in Barcelona Announce Complete Ban on Short-Term Rentals to Tourists Starting in 2028

What We Know

Barcelona City Hall has officially announced a plan to ban all short-term rentals to tourists by November 2028. This decision affects approximately 10,101 apartments that currently hold tourist rental licenses, which will not be renewed once they expire (BBC, Reuters). The city's Deputy Mayor, Laia Bonet, emphasized that the move aims to prioritize housing for full-time residents amid rising rents and a housing crisis that has seen rental prices soar by 68% over the past decade (AP News, Forbes).

The decision comes in response to growing public sentiment against overtourism and its impact on local communities, with many residents feeling priced out of their own neighborhoods (BBC). Protests have erupted in the city, with demonstrators calling for an end to practices that exacerbate the housing crisis (AP News).

Analysis

The announcement from Barcelona's authorities is corroborated by multiple reputable sources, including major news outlets like CNN and Reuters. These reports confirm that the city is taking significant steps to address the housing crisis by phasing out short-term rentals, which have been linked to rising living costs and displacement of local residents.

The credibility of these sources is high, as they are established news organizations with a history of accurate reporting. The information provided aligns with the broader context of housing issues in tourist-heavy cities, where the balance between tourism and local living conditions is increasingly contentious (Forbes, Lodgify).

However, some property owners and stakeholders in the tourism sector have expressed concerns about the potential economic impact of such a ban, arguing that it could lead to a shortage of temporary accommodations for visitors (AP News, Forbes). This perspective highlights the ongoing debate about the best approach to manage tourism while ensuring affordable housing for residents.

Conclusion

The claim that authorities in Barcelona have announced a complete ban on short-term rentals to tourists starting in 2028 is True. The decision is backed by official statements from city officials and is supported by multiple credible news sources. The ban is a response to the growing housing crisis exacerbated by the influx of short-term rentals, aiming to prioritize the needs of local residents over tourism.
